What types of surface areas can a long-neck sander be used on?
Long-neck sanders are perfect for drywall, plaster, wood, and some concrete surfaces. Each surface might need specific sanding pads or techniques.
2. How do I know which grit sandpaper to utilize?
Choosing the ideal grit includes beginning with a coarser grit for heavy material elimination, then moving towards finer grits for smoothing out the surface area.
3. Is a long-neck sander required for small tasks?
While useful for large areas, for little tasks or details, a manual sander may be enough. However, using a long-neck sander normally offers a more uniform finish.

5. How regularly should the sandpaper be changed?
The frequency of sandpaper replacement varies depending upon the material being worked on and the depth of sanding. Usually, once the sandpaper appears blocked or ineffective, it should be altered.
